Are Doritos Gluten Free?

Doritos is an American brand of flavored tortilla chips produced since 1964 by Frito-Lay, a wholly owned subsidiary of PepsiCo. The original Doritos were not flavored. The first flavor was Taco, released in 1967, though other flavors have since debuted for the company.

Question: Are Doritos Tortilla Chips gluten-free?

The answer is: Yes*

*Note: Made in a factory that also handles: Milk, Wheat, Gluten, Barley, Soya

Only one flavour in the USA is completely Gluten-Free : DORITOS® Simply Organic White Cheddar Flavored Tortilla Chips.

The other flavours do not contain Gluten Ingredients however, they are manufactured on the same lines as products that contain gluten.

Doritos ingredients

Whole corn, vegetable oil (corn, soybean, and/or sunflower oil), salt, cheddar cheese (milk, cheese cultures, salt, enzymes), maltodextrin, whey, monosodium glutamate, buttermilk solids, romano cheese (part skim cow’s milk, cheese cultures, salt, enzymes), whey protein concentrate, onion powder, partially hydrogenated soybean and cottonseed oil, corn flour, disodium phosphate, lactose, natural and artificial flavor, dextrose, tomato powder, spices, lactic acid, artificial color (including Yellow 6, Yellow 5, Red 40), citric acid, sugar, garlic powder, red and green bell pepper powder, sodium caseinate, disodium inosinate, disodium guanylate, nonfat milk solids, whey protein isolate, corn syrup solids.
